Landscape Hardscaping in Fairfield County, CT

Landscape hardscaping services involve the installation and construction of durable, non-living features that enhance the structure and functionality of outdoor spaces. Typical projects include patios, walkways, retaining walls, fire pits, outdoor kitchens, and decorative stone or brick features. These elements can define different areas of a yard, improve accessibility, and add visual interest. Property owners interested in hardscaping should consider factors such as the intended use of the space, design preferences, and the types of materials that best complement their existing landscape.

Before requesting hardscaping services, homeowners often want to understand the scope of the project, including the materials involved, the overall design, and any necessary preparation or permits. It’s also helpful to consider how the new features will integrate with existing landscaping or other outdoor elements. Clear communication about goals and expectations can ensure the project aligns with the property owner’s vision and enhances the outdoor environment effectively.

Project Types

Common Landscape Hardscaping Jobs

Paver patios - durable and attractive surfaces for outdoor entertaining and relaxation.

Retaining walls - functional structures to manage slope stability and define landscape levels.

Walkways and paths - practical routes that enhance accessibility and curb appeal.

Driveway installations - sturdy surfaces designed to withstand vehicle traffic and weather conditions.

Deck and terrace hardscapes - solid platforms for outdoor living spaces and gatherings.

Fire pits and outdoor features - permanent elements that create inviting focal points in the yard.

Landscape Hardscaping Questions

What types of projects are covered by landscape hardscaping services? Hardscaping services typically include patios, walkways, retaining walls, fire pits, and outdoor kitchens to enhance outdoor living spaces.

Are there design options available for hardscaping features? Yes, a variety of materials and styles can be incorporated to match the property's aesthetic and functional needs.

What materials are commonly used in hardscaping projects? Common materials include brick, stone, concrete, and pavers, chosen for durability and visual appeal.

How can hardscaping improve a property's outdoor space? Hardscaping adds structure, functionality, and visual interest, creating inviting areas for relaxation and entertainment.
